How many other two digit numbers increase by 18 when their digits are reversed? Question When you reverse the digits of the number 13, the number increases by 18. How many other two digit numbers increase by 18 when their digits are reversed? ___ Open in App Solution Let 10x + y be a two digit number, where x and y are positive single digit integers and x > 0 . Its reverse = 10y + x Now, 10y + x - 10x - y = 18 ∴ 9(y - x) = 18 ∴ y - x = 2 Thus y and x can be (1, 3), (2, 4), (3, 5), (4, 6), (5, 7), (6, 8) and (7, 9) ∴ Other than 13, there are 6 such numbers.
